The minimum school leaving age increased from 12 to 14 in 1918, to 15 in 1947 and 16 in 1972. The Education Act 1902 which replaced School Boards with local education authorities WebThe 1944 Education Act announced that the UK''s minimum school leaving age would be raised from 14 to 15 within three years. The actual increase came into effect on 1 April 1947. WebThe Education Act 1944 (7 and 8 Geo 6 c. 31) made major changes in the provision and governance of secondary schools in England and Wales. It is also known as the "Butler Act" after the President of the Board of Education, R. A. Butler.Historians consider it a "triumph for progressive reform," and it became a core element of the post-war …

WebPost 16 options. You can leave school on the last Friday in June if you'll be 16 by the end of the summer holidays. You must then choose whether to: stay in full-time education - for example at school, sixth form college, further education college or University Technical College (UTC) spend 20 hours or more a week working or volunteering while ...
